Earlsfield offers a variety of amenities to ensure a comfortable travel experience. The ticket office at the station operates during the peak hours, opening early in the morning from 06:30 on weekdays, with reduced hours over the weekend. For those swift in purchasing their tickets on the move, ticket machines are readily available. They're also equipped for online ticket collection and offer accessible services, including Disabled Persons Railcard discounts.
Traveling offers so much more when you have additional support and facilities. Earlsfield station ensures this with step-free access across the premises, making it convenient for passengers with mobility needs. Additionally, accessible ticket machines, helpful personnel, and strategically located customer help points are there to assist you. Interestingly, on a chilly day, while waiting for your train, you might find the seating area comforting, though there aren't designated waiting rooms.
While the station doesn't boast a plethora of shops, there's a refreshment kiosk located on Platform 2 to keep you fueled. An ATM is available for those in need of quick cash access. While public Wi-Fi spans the area, there’s no pay phone facility, so keeping your mobile charged might be handy.

Longbridge Station is equipped with facilities designed to make your journey as seamless as possible. The ticket office is readily accessible six days a week, from 6:00 AM to 8:00 PM on weekdays, providing all the assistance you might need. On Sundays, it opens from 9:30 AM to 3:00 PM. Ticket machines are available, ensuring that purchasing and collecting pre-bought tickets is hassle-free. An induction loop is available for passengers with hearing impairments, further enhancing accessibility.
For those requiring step-free access, Longbridge Station does not disappoint. Classified under a category 'A' for accessibility, it offers step-free access to all platforms. While there are no waiting rooms, seating areas are available for those who prefer to rest while they await their journeys. Convenient facilities, such as accessible toilets, are located in the booking hall and are available during ticket office hours.
Connectivity doesn't end with the train services. Longbridge Station is well-served by alternative transport links that enhance your options for onward travel. There are bus services and taxis readily accessible from the station. In case of any disruptions, rail replacement services are also offered, with detailed information accessible online.
